The Mazda repair market in Port Orford is characterized by its limited size and the generalist nature of its service providers. There are no dealerships or shops that advertise exclusive Mazda or rotary engine specialization. The quality of service is generally high, driven by the need for local shops to be versatile and trustworthy in a small community where reputation is paramount. Competition is moderate among the few established shops, but it is not cutthroat, as each has built a steady clientele. Typical pricing is competitive for a rural coastal area, generally lower than in larger cities like Coos Bay or North Bend but reflective of higher overhead costs compared to inland towns. For highly specialized services like Mazda Connect programming or definitive rotary engine rebuilds, owners should expect to travel to a dedicated specialist or dealership located in larger regional hubs, potentially over an hour away. The local shops are best utilized for mechanical repairs, diagnostics, and routine maintenance.
